Transaction 90895875dd83772a47323b65fa2f9520d4fa4b0bc5b08c59bfda7ff60241b673
1 Input
1 Output
-
90895875dd83772a47323b65fa2f9520d4fa4b0bc5b08c59bfda7ff60241b673:0
- value
- 356297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b94052b60ecf59fb68d02334baf334c9720dd0f OP_EQUAL
- address
- 3CxSMmAMRHGdvtHYyHfEEFAciwp32vbTdP